Jason Phillips

To this point as I'm writing this post, Jason Phillips is the only Major League Baseball player to ever have been inside my home. He gave my son hitting lessons back in 2020. At that time, I didn't have a card of him to sign! Kind of odd that I wasn't prepared, in that respect. Jason had eventually moved to Atlanta, Georgia to accept a position with Perfect Game as a scout. In June of 2023 my son was invited to join the St. Pete Wahoos as a guest player for the Perfect Game 11u National World Series tournament, held just outside of Atlanta. I had sent Jason a text to see if he would be there and if so, my son and I would bring his cards with us for him to sign. He said he'd be happy to do so!
On Sunday, June 18, 2023 Jason came over to watch a little bit of my son play. My kid was on fire during this tournament and was smacking the ball all around the field. Jason saw my son lead off and rip a ball down the first base line. However, the first baseman made an unbelievable defensive play as he dove for the ball and was able to get to his feet and to the bag for the out. Jason was impressed with my son's swing and speed, and told my son after the game, "You were robbed!" He continued to chat with us for a few minutes and then signed a 2004 Topps card for me as well as a 2005 Topps card for my son.
